阅读:1172回复:2
9052的一些寄存器问题?
我想问问:
1: pci配置寄存器它的基地址是系统自动分配的吗?如果不是,那是怎样确定的? 2: PCI总线要读写LOCAL配置寄存器,是不是通过pci base address 0 for memory access to local configuration registers 和 pci base address 0 for io access to local configuration registers 两个寄存器映射到LOCAL寄存器,然后对PCI的这两个地址段写数据就是对LOCAL寄存器进行操作了?如果不是的,那又如何对LOCAL配置寄存器操作的? 3:如果2成立的话,那上面的两个PCI寄存器同时映射到LOCAL配置寄存器,这不就冲突了,同时有两个地址对应LOCAL配置寄存器,如何解释呢? 4:在写入space空间的range的时候 是不是写0有效呢?比如 1M 写成 FFF00000,如果是写0有效 还有什么地方是写0有效? |
|
沙发#
发布于:2004-08-05 17:10
用户被禁言,该主题自动屏蔽! |
|
板凳#
发布于:2004-08-05 17:41
TOM大哥,PCI来操作LOCAL配置寄存器是如何操作的,能说具体点吗?
|
|